Comme montré dans la figure ci-dessus, exécutez la commande des clés *, la valeur de la clé contient le chinois, et elle ne peut alors pas être affichée directement en chinois, comme montré dans la figure ci-dessus,
Au final, Internet est codé « ISO-8859-1 », mais aucune information officielle pertinente n’est disponible.
>>> « \xe6\xb2\xaaFN123 ».encode(« iso-8859-1 »).decode('utf8') « Shanghai FN123 » Transformation d’encodage en Python, comme montré dans la figure ci-dessous :
Il existe également un moyen d’afficher directement le chinois dans le client redis, comme suit :
1. Ouvrir CMD.exe fenêtre de ligne de commande
2. Modifiez la page de codes via la commande chcp, et la page de codes de UTF-8 est 65001
Après cela, la page de codes est transformée en UTF-8. Cependant, les caractères UTF-8 ne s’affichent toujours pas correctement dans la fenêtre.
3. Modifier les propriétés de la fenêtre et modifier les polices
Faites un clic droit sur la barre de titre de la ligne de commande, sélectionnez Propriétés - > Polices, changez la police en la police True Type « Lucida Console », puis cliquez sur OK pour appliquer les propriétés à la fenêtre actuelle. Comme le montre la figure suivante :
Enfin, ajoutez le paramètre --raw lorsque le client se connecte ! Comme montré ci-dessous :
Cependant, avec cette méthode, je ne peux pas entrer le chinois dans la commande cmd, donc je ne peux pas exécuter la commande get !
|